Default Some experiences trying the patch & hotfix last night

So a few thoughts:

- London FPS test, all settings more or less maxed out except buildings on medium @ 1920 x 1200: Smoother than before! Getting about 30-35 fps flying low level with no stutters. Haven't had much problems before either.

- Full screen works nicely for me

- AI pilots on some still wacos especially on larger planes, not sure if that was tweaked much though with this release

- Tried MP on a german server: worked ok with no fps or stutter issues. Had some hickups / stuttering on sounds though that popped in and out every 5 mins or so. Haven't cleared any caches or done any other tricks are posted..

- Hung once after joining MP server when selecting the army (chose a plane first, not sure if there's a connection). Had to cold start my pc.

- The briefing & plane customization screens finally before a mission are a godsend! Missed a zoom on the map though, is there one?

So overall a good release for me so thanks a lot for your efforts!
